在Debian系统中,软件更新是一个重要的过程,用于确保系统的安全性、稳定性和最新性。以下是Debian系统软件更新的详细流程:
更新软件包列表
首先,打开终端并运行以下命令来更新本地软件包索引:
sudo apt update
这会从官方存储库获取有关可用软件包和更新的最新信息。
升级已安装的软件包
接下来,运行以下命令来安装所有可用的更新:
sudo apt upgrade
此命令会使用已更新的软件包版本替换所有旧版本。
进行完整的系统升级
如果你希望安装所有更新,包括新版本的安全补丁和功能改进,可以使用以下命令:
sudo apt full-upgrade
此命令不仅会升级已安装的软件包,还会安装或删除内核和依赖项以确保系统的一致性。
可选的高级更新操作
- 删除过时的软件包:使用以下命令来删除不再需要的依赖包和不再使用的软件包,以节省磁盘空间:
sudo apt autoremove
- 清除软件包缓存:运行以下命令来清除下载的软件包缓存,以释放磁盘空间:
sudo apt clean
使用图形界面更新软件
对于那些更喜欢使用图形界面的人,Debian提供了“软件更新器”应用程序。操作步骤如下:
- 打开“软件更新器”应用程序。
- 单击“检查”按钮。
- 如果发现更新,单击“安装更新”按钮。
自动更新配置
为了方便起见,您可以配置Debian自动更新软件。使用以下命令:
sudo nano /etc/apt/apt.conf.d/20auto-upgrades
添加以下行:
APT::Periodic::Update-Package-Lists "1"; APT::Periodic::Unattended-Upgrade "1";
保存文件并重启apt服务:
sudo systemctl restart apt
这将每天检查更新并自动安装安全更新。
注意事项
- 在进行系统更新之前,务必备份重要数据,以防更新过程中出现问题导致数据丢失。
- 建议使用官方或可信的源进行更新,以确保获取到的是稳定且安全的版本。
- 更新过程中,密切关注终端输出的信息,以便及时发现并解决可能出现的问题。
- 更新完成后,可能需要重启相关服务或整个系统以使更新生效。
通过遵循上述步骤和注意事项,你可以安全且有效地更新你的Debian系统。